I wander'd lonely as a cloud
That floats on high o'er vales and hills,
When all at once I saw a crowd.
A host of golden daffodils;
i. Which two words describe the number of daffodils?
ii
. Who does the 'I' in the first line refer to?
iii. Identify the simile in these lines.

The words "crowd" and "host" define the large number of daffodils.
In the above lines, I refers to William Wordsworth.
"lonely as a cloud" is the simile
